The Web Application Hacker's Handbook,

4.5

بر اساس نظر کاربران

شما میتونید سوالاتتون در باره کتاب رو از هوش مصنوعیش بعد از ورود بپرسید
هر دانلود یا پرسش از هوش مصنوعی 2 امتیاز لازم دارد، برای بدست آوردن امتیاز رایگان، به صفحه ی راهنمای امتیازات سر بزنید و یک سری کار ارزشمند انجام بدین

مقدمه‌ای بر کتاب 'The Web Application Hacker's Handbook'

کتاب 'The Web Application Hacker's Handbook' یکی از منابع جامع و ضروری در حوزه امنیت وب است که توسط مارکوس پینتو و دیفید استاتارد نوشته شده است. این کتاب به بررسی تکنیک‌ها و استراتژی‌های مختلفی می‌پردازد که هکرها و کارشناسان امنیت برای نفوذ و تست امنیتی نرم‌افزارهای وب به کار می‌برند.

خلاصه‌ جامع کتاب

این کتاب در ۲۰ بخش مختلف موضوعاتی مانند Cross-Site Scripting (XSS)، SQL Injection، CSRF، و بسیاری از حملات دیگر را به طور کامل پوشش می‌دهد. علاوه بر این، به تحلیل معماری‌های مختلف وب، مشکلات امنیتی موجود در آنها، و روش‌های پیشگیری و رفع آنها پرداخته شده است. نویسندگان با ارائه مثال‌های واقعی و کاربردی، به خوانندگان کمک می‌کنند تا بهتر بتوانند خود را با تهدیدات امنیتی آشنا کنند و راه‌حل‌های موثر برای مقابله با آنها بیابند.

نکات کلیدی

  • آشنایی با ابزارها و تکنیک‌های مختلف تست نفوذ و شناسایی آسیب‌پذیری‌های برنامه‌های وب.
  • تحلیل دقیق و گام به گام ضعف‌های امنیتی و روش‌های سوءاستفاده از آنها.
  • روش‌های برقراری امنیت در نرم‌افزارهای وب از طراحی تا پیاده‌سازی.

اقتباس‌های مشهور از کتاب

"امنیت وب مانند یک هدف متحرک است؛ هر چه بیشتر تلاش کنید، چالش‌های جدیدتری ظاهر می‌شوند."

مارکوس پینتو و دیفید استاتارد

"برای فهم بهتر تهدیدات، ابتدا باید از روش‌ها و تفکرات یک هکر استفاده کنید."

مارکوس پینتو و دیفید استاتارد

اهمیت کتاب

کتاب 'The Web Application Hacker's Handbook' به دلیل دید وسیعی که نسبت به امنیت برنامه‌های وب در اختیار خوانندگان خود قرار می‌دهد، بسیار ارزشمند است. با توجه به گسترش روزافزون استفاده از برنامه‌های وب و افزایش تهدیدات امنیتی، داشتن درکی عمیق از نقاط ضعف و راه‌حل‌های موجود برای مقابله با آنها امری ضروری است. این کتاب نه تنها برای هکرهای اخلاقی و کارشناسان امنیتی، بلکه برای توسعه‌دهندگان و طراحان نرم‌افزار نیز توصیه می‌شود تا بتوانند از همان مراحل اولیه توسعه، امنیت را در طراحی خود مدنظر قرار دهند.

Introduction to 'The Web Application Hacker's Handbook'

Welcome to the world of web application security, where understanding vulnerabilities can be as powerful as exploiting them. "The Web Application Hacker's Handbook" has established itself as a cornerstone in learning about web application security and penetration testing. Authored by Marcus Pinto and Dafydd Stuttard, this book serves both as a comprehensive guide for beginners and a detailed technical manual for seasoned professionals.

Detailed Summary of the Book

"The Web Application Hacker's Handbook" dives deep into the architecture and inner workings of web applications, breaking down complex concepts into understandable segments. The book encompasses a myriad of essential topics, such as mapping the application, identifying entry points, and understanding vulnerabilities in web applications. From understanding the basics of HTTP protocols to discovering sophisticated techniques to exploit security fails, this handbook offers in-depth coverage of various attack methodologies.

The book is structured to guide you through the entire process of becoming adept at testing the security of web applications. It begins with the core technologies underpinning the web, leading to practical strategies in detecting and exploiting common weaknesses, including authentication flaws, input and output handling, and session management. What's remarkable about this book is its balanced composition of theoretical insight alongside practical, real-world examples.

Key Takeaways

  • Detailed explanation of web technologies and how they can be both understood and manipulated for security purposes.
  • Comprehensive guide to understanding common web application vulnerabilities such as SQL Injection, Cross-site Scripting (XSS), and Cross-site Request Forgery (CSRF).
  • In-depth discussion about the tools and techniques used for web application penetration testing.
  • Practical approaches to balancing security testing efforts with real-world constraints.
  • Hands-on advice about reporting findings and the broader aspects of security testing methodologies.

Famous Quotes from the Book

One of the standout quotes from the book encapsulates the essence of web security:

"To be a successful web application hacker, you need to develop a mindset that considers all possible states and inputs, including those not deliberately implemented by the developer."

This quote embodies the proactive approach necessary for identifying security weaknesses in web applications.

Why This Book Matters

In today's digital age, web applications are ubiquitous, and their security is crucial to protecting sensitive data and maintaining user trust. "The Web Application Hacker's Handbook" is more than just a book; it's an essential toolkit for anyone involved in the field of web security. The authors have distilled years of experience into a guide that equips readers with the knowledge to anticipate and counteract potential security threats effectively.

With cyber threats becoming increasingly sophisticated, the necessity for thorough security assessments cannot be overstated. This book not only equips you with the technical skills needed but also encourages the development of a security-oriented mindset crucial for navigating and mitigating today’s diverse threat landscape.

دانلود رایگان مستقیم

برای دانلود رایگان این کتاب و هزاران کتاب دیگه همین حالا عضو بشین

نویسندگان:


نظرات:


4.5

بر اساس 0 نظر کاربران